1. feat: add MCP SSE stateful session load balancer support
Related PR: #2818 | Contributor: @johnlanni
Usage Background
As the demand for real-time communication grows, Server-Sent Events (SSE) have become a key technology for many applications. However, in distributed systems, ensuring that requests from the same client are always routed to the same backend service to maintain session state has been a challenge. Traditional load balancing strategies cannot meet this need. This feature addresses this issue by introducing MCP SSE stateful session load balancing support. By specifying the mcp-sse type in the higress.io/load-balance annotation, users can easily manage SSE connection state sessions. The target user group mainly consists of application developers and service providers who need to perform real-time data pushing in distributed environments.
Feature Details
This PR mainly implements the following features:
- Extend
load-balanceannotation: In theloadbalance.gofile, support for themcp-ssevalue is added, and theMcpSseStatefulfield is added to theLoadBalanceConfigstruct. - Simplified Configuration: Users only need to set
mcp-ssein thehigress.io/load-balanceannotation to enable this feature, with no additional configuration required. - Backend Address Encoding: When MCP SSE stateful session load balancing is enabled, the backend address will be Base64 encoded and embedded in the session ID of the SSE message. This ensures that the client can correctly identify and maintain the session. The core innovation lies in dynamically generating SSE session-related configurations through EnvoyFilter, thereby achieving stateful session management.
Usage Instructions
To use this feature, users need to follow these steps:
- Enable the Feature: Add the
higress.io/load-balance: mcp-sseannotation to the Ingress resource. - Configuration Example:
apiVersion: networking.k8s.io/v1
kind: Ingress
metadata:
name: sse-ingress
annotations:
higress.io/load-balance: mcp-sse
spec:
rules:
- host: example.com
http:
paths:
- path: /mcp-servers/test/sse
pathType: Prefix
backend:
service:
name: sse-service
port:
number: 80
- Testing: Access the SSE endpoint using the
curlcommand and check if the returned messages contain the correct session ID. Notes:
- Ensure that the backend service can handle Base64 encoded session IDs.
- Avoid frequent changes to the backend service deployment to prevent session consistency issues.
Feature Value
This feature brings the following specific benefits to users:
- Session Consistency: Ensures that requests from the same client are always routed to the same backend service, maintaining session state consistency.
- Simplified Configuration: Enables the feature with simple annotation configuration, reducing the complexity of user configuration.
- Enhanced User Experience: For applications that rely on SSE, such as real-time notifications and stock market data, it provides a more stable and consistent service experience.
- Reduced Operations Costs: Reduces errors and failures caused by inconsistent sessions, lowering the workload of the operations team.
2. feat: Support adding a proxy server in between when forwarding requests to upstream
Related PR: #2710 | Contributor: @CH3CHO
Usage Background
In modern microservice architectures, especially in complex network environments, directly forwarding requests from the client to the backend service may encounter various issues, such as network security and performance bottlenecks. Introducing an intermediate proxy server can effectively solve these problems, for example, by performing traffic control, load balancing, and SSL offloading through the proxy server. Additionally, in some cases, enterprises may need to use specific proxy servers to meet compliance and security requirements. The target user group for this feature mainly consists of enterprises and developers who need to optimize request forwarding paths in complex network environments.
Feature Details
This PR mainly implements the ability to configure one or more proxy servers in the McpBridge resource and allows specifying proxy servers for each registry. The specific implementation includes:
- Adding the
proxiesfield in theMcpBridgeresource definition to configure the list of proxy servers, and adding theproxyNamefield in theregistriesitem to associate the proxy server with the registry. - When creating or updating the
McpBridgeresource, the system automatically generates the corresponding EnvoyFilter resources, which define how to forward requests to the specified proxy server. - Additionally, EnvoyFilters are generated for each service bound to a proxy, ensuring they correctly point to the local listener on the corresponding proxy server. The entire technical implementation is based on Envoy's advanced routing capabilities, demonstrating the project's powerful functionality in handling complex network topologies.
Usage Instructions
To enable this feature, at least one proxy server must first be configured in the McpBridge resource. This can be done by adding new ProxyConfig objects to the spec.proxies array, each containing necessary information such as name, serverAddress, and serverPort. Next, for the registry entries that need to use a proxy server, simply reference the defined proxy name in their proxyName field. Once configured, the system will automatically handle all related EnvoyFilter generation work. It is worth noting that before actual deployment, the correctness of the configuration files should be carefully checked to avoid service unavailability due to misconfiguration.
Feature Value
The newly added proxy server support feature greatly enhances the system's network flexibility, allowing users to flexibly adjust request forwarding paths according to their needs. For example, by setting up different proxy servers, it is easy to achieve data transmission optimization across multiple regions; at the same time, with the additional security features provided by the proxy layer (such as SSL encryption), the overall system security is significantly improved. In addition, this feature also helps simplify operations management, especially in situations where frequent adjustments to the network architecture are needed. Through simple configuration changes, rapid responses to changes can be achieved without major modifications to the underlying infrastructure. In summary, this improvement not only expands the project's scope but also provides users with more powerful tools to tackle increasingly complex network challenges.
3. feat(ai-proxy): add auto protocol compatibility for OpenAI and Claude APIs
Related PR: #2810 | Contributor: @johnlanni
Usage Background
In the AI proxy plugin, users may need to interact with multiple AI service providers (such as OpenAI and Anthropic Claude) simultaneously. These providers typically use different API protocols, leading to the need for manual configuration of protocol types when switching services, which increases complexity and the likelihood of errors. This feature solves this problem, allowing users to seamlessly use different providers' services without worrying about the differences in underlying protocols. The target user group consists of developers and enterprises who want to simplify the AI service integration process.
Feature Details
This PR implements the automatic protocol compatibility feature. The core technological innovation lies in automatically detecting the request path and intelligently converting the protocol based on the target provider's capabilities. Specifically, when the request path is /v1/chat/completions, it is recognized as the OpenAI protocol; when the request path is /v1/messages, it is recognized as the Claude protocol. If the target provider does not support the native Claude protocol, the plugin converts the request from Claude format to OpenAI format, and vice versa. In the main.go file, new logic for automatic protocol detection based on the request path is added, and path replacements are made as necessary. Additionally, a new claude_to_openai.go file is added to implement the specific conversion logic from Claude to OpenAI protocol.
Usage Instructions
Enabling this feature is very simple; users just need to send requests as usual, with no additional configuration required. For example, for OpenAI protocol requests, the URL is http://your-domain/v1/chat/completions, and for Claude protocol requests, the URL is http://your-domain/v1/messages. The plugin will automatically detect and handle protocol conversion. If the target provider does not support the Claude protocol, the plugin will convert it to OpenAI format. Example configuration is as follows:
provider:
type: claude # Provider natively supporting the Claude protocol
apiTokens:
- 'YOUR_CLAUDE_API_TOKEN'
version: '2023-06-01'
Notes: Ensure that the API token and version number are correctly configured so that the plugin can correctly identify and process the requests.
Feature Value
This feature significantly improves the usability and flexibility of the AI proxy plugin, reducing the user's configuration burden. Through automatic protocol detection and intelligent conversion, users can more easily switch between different AI service providers without worrying about protocol compatibility issues. This not only improves development efficiency but also enhances the stability and reliability of the system. Additionally, the feature supports streaming responses, further expanding its application scenarios, especially in cases requiring real-time interaction. In summary, this feature provides users with a more efficient and convenient way to integrate and manage multiple AI service providers.

🚀 New Features (Features)
-
Related PR: #2847
Contributor: @Erica177
Change Log: This PR adds a security mode for Nacos MCP, involving modifications tomcp_model.goandwatcher.gofiles, including the addition and adjustment of configuration options.
Feature Value: By adding security mode support, the security of Nacos MCP services is enhanced, allowing users to manage their microservice configurations in a more secure environment. -
Related PR: #2842
Contributor: @hanxiantao
Change Log: Added detailed Chinese and English documentation for the hmac-auth-apisix plugin and added corresponding test cases to ensure the stability and reliability of the newly added features.
Feature Value: By adding documentation and tests, the availability and stability of the hmac-auth-apisix plugin are improved, helping users better understand and use the HMAC authentication mechanism, enhancing API security. -
Related PR: #2823
Contributor: @johnlanni
Change Log: Added OpenRouter as an AI service provider, supporting access to various AI models through a unified API. Core implementations include support for chat completions and text completions.
Feature Value: By introducing OpenRouter, users can more flexibly choose different AI models and interact with them, simplifying the complexity of cross-platform AI service usage and enhancing the user experience. -
Related PR: #2815
Contributor: @hanxiantao
Change Log: This PR adds the hmac-auth-apisix plugin, implementing API request authentication functionality. It verifies the integrity and authenticity of requests by generating signatures using the HMAC algorithm.
Feature Value: The newly added hmac-auth-apisix plugin enhances system security, ensuring that only authenticated clients can access protected resources, improving the user experience and system protection capabilities. -
Related PR: #2808
Contributor: @daixijun
Change Log: Added support for the Anthropic API and the OpenAI v1/models interface, expanding the compatibility and functional scope of DeepSeek.
Feature Value: The introduction of new support allows users to leverage more artificial intelligence service options, enhancing the system's flexibility and practicality. -
Related PR: #2805
Contributor: @johnlanni
Change Log: Added a JSON-RPC protocol conversion plugin, capable of extracting request and response information from MCP protocol to headers, facilitating further observation, rate limiting, and authentication processing.
Feature Value: This feature allows users to utilize JSON-RPC for higher-level policy control in A2A protocols, such as authentication and traffic management, thereby enhancing the system's flexibility and security. -
Related PR: #2788
Contributor: @zat366
Change Log: This PR updates the dependencygithub.com/higress-group/wasm-goin mcp-server to support MCP plugin responses with images. This is achieved by updating thego.modandgo.sumfiles.
Feature Value: The new feature allows MCP plugins to handle and respond to image data, enhancing the system's multimedia processing capabilities and providing users with richer content display options. -
Related PR: #2769
Contributor: @github-actions[bot]
Change Log: This PR updates the CRD files in thehelmfolder, adding new attribute definitions forproxies.
Feature Value: By updating the CRD files to add new attributes, the Kubernetes resource definitions become more enriched and complete, enhancing the system's configuration flexibility and extensibility. -
Related PR: #2761
Contributor: @johnlanni
Change Log: This PR introduces two new deduplication strategies:SPLIT_AND_RETAIN_FIRSTandSPLIT_AND_RETAIN_LAST, used to retain the first and last elements of comma-separated header values, respectively.
Feature Value: The new strategies provide users with more granular control options, allowing them to choose to retain specific position data during deduplication operations, thus better meeting diverse needs. -
Related PR: #2739
Contributor: @WeixinX
Change Log: Added a new plugin configuration fieldreroute, allowing users to control whether to disable route reselection. This feature is implemented by modifying the main configuration file and adding relevant test cases.
Feature Value: This feature provides users with a way to finely control the routing behavior during request processing, enhancing the system's flexibility and configurability, and meeting the needs of specific scenarios. -
Related PR: #2730
Contributor: @rinfx
Change Log: This PR adds tool usage support for the Bedrock service by modifying the structures and logic inbedrock.goand other files, enabling the system to handle tool-related requests.
Feature Value: The new feature allows users to effectively utilize tool invocation capabilities in the Bedrock environment, enhancing the system's flexibility and functionality, and better meeting the needs of applications that require external tool integration. -
Related PR: #2729
Contributor: @rinfx
Change Log: This PR adds a length limit for each value in the AI statistics plugin, automatically truncating when the length exceeds the set limit. This helps reduce memory usage when processing large files such as base64-encoded images and videos.
Feature Value: By limiting and truncating overly long data values, this feature can effectively prevent memory overflow issues caused by logging large media files, thereby improving system stability and performance. -
Related PR: #2713
Contributor: @Aias00
Change Log: This PR adds Grok provider support for the AI proxy, including the addition of Grok Go files and updates to related documentation.
Feature Value: By integrating Grok as a new AI provider, users can now leverage Grok's AI capabilities to process requests, increasing the system's flexibility and functional diversity. -
Related PR: #2712
Contributor: @SCMRCORE
Change Log: Added support for the Gemini model thinking function, specifically adapting to the 2.5 Flash, 2.5 Pro, and 2.5 Flash-Lite models.
Feature Value: This enhancement improves the functionality of the AI proxy plugin, allowing users to utilize specific Gemini models for more complex thinking tasks, enhancing the user experience and application scope. -
Related PR: #2704
Contributor: @hanxiantao
Change Log: This PR implements the functionality of Rust WASM plugin support for Redis database configuration options and improves thedemo-wasmto retrieve Redis configuration from the Wasm plugin configuration.
Feature Value: This feature allows developers to more flexibly configure and integrate Redis databases when using Rust WASM plugins, improving development efficiency and the configurability of applications. -
Related PR: #2698
Contributor: @erasernoob
Change Log: Implemented support for multimodal data in the Gemini model, adding the ability to handle images and text. This is achieved by introducing new dependencies and modifying existing code logic.
Feature Value: This enhancement strengthens the functionality of the AI proxy plugin, allowing it to support more complex multimodal data processing, providing users with a richer and more flexible AI service experience. -
Related PR: #2696
Contributor: @rinfx
Change Log: This PR introduces streaming response support when the content security plugin is enabled, adjusting the detection frequency via thebufferLimitparameter to improve the flexibility and efficiency of content detection.
Feature Value: The new streaming response feature allows users to more efficiently handle content security detection, reducing latency and improving the user experience, especially in scenarios requiring real-time feedback. -
Related PR: #2671
Contributor: @Aias00
Change Log: Implemented path suffix and content type filtering functionality to address performance and resource management issues in the ai-statistics plugin. By introducing the SkipProcessing mechanism, it avoids indiscriminate processing of all requests and reduces unnecessary response body caching.
Feature Value: This enhancement improves the selective processing capability of the AI statistics plugin, enhancing system performance and optimizing resource usage efficiency. It is particularly beneficial for scenarios with a large number of complex API requests, significantly improving the user experience.
🐛 Bug Fixes (Bug Fixes)
-
Related PR: #2816
Contributor: @Asnowww
Change Log: This PR corrects a spelling error in thescanners-user-agents.datafile, changing 'scannr' to 'scanner'.
Feature Value: Correcting spelling errors in the documentation improves the accuracy and readability of the document, helping users better understand and use the related features. -
Related PR: #2799
Contributor: @erasernoob
Change Log: This PR fixes the wasm-go-build plugin build command to ensure that all files in the directory are included during compilation, solving the compilation failure issue caused by missing dependencies.
Feature Value: By fixing the build command, this PR prevents compilation errors due to missing files, enhancing the stability and reliability of the build process and providing a better development experience for developers. -
Related PR: #2787
Contributor: @co63oc
Change Log: This PR fixes a spelling error in theRegisteTickFuncfunction, ensuring the correctness of the timer task registration. By correcting the function name, it avoids potential functional failures.
Feature Value: This fix corrects the issue where timer tasks could not be registered correctly due to a spelling error, enhancing the system's stability and reliability and ensuring that applications dependent on timer task execution run as expected. -
Related PR: #2786
Contributor: @CH3CHO
Change Log: This PR removes theaccept-encodingheader when the mcp-session filter handles SSE transport requests, solving the issue of incorrect handling of compressed response body data.
Feature Value: This fix ensures that the MCP server can work correctly when using SSE transport upstream, avoiding data parsing errors due to compression and enhancing the system's stability and reliability. -
Related PR: #2782
Contributor: @CH3CHO
Change Log: This PR fixes the issue of the Azure URL configuration component being unexpectedly changed, ensuring the correctness and consistency of the URL components by defining a new enum typeazureServiceUrlType.
Feature Value: This fix ensures that users can maintain their original Azure service URL configuration when using the AI proxy, avoiding service call failures or inconsistencies due to incorrect changes. -
Related PR: #2757
Contributor: @Jing-ze
Change Log: This PR fixes the issue with the mcp server building Envoy filter unit tests, ensuring the correctness and stability of the test cases.
Feature Value: By fixing the errors in the unit tests, this PR enhances the reliability and maintainability of the code, helping developers better perform subsequent development and debugging work. -
Related PR: #2755
Contributor: @CH3CHO
Change Log: This PR fixes the issue where adding duplicate IPs in the ip-restriction configuration would throw an error, by ignoring the error for existing IPs and displaying the specific error details from iptree.
Feature Value: Allowing duplicate entries in the IP restriction list improves configuration flexibility and user experience while ensuring that other types of errors are still handled effectively. -
Related PR: #2754
Contributor: @Jing-ze
Change Log: This PR corrects the stopping and buffering issues when decoding data in golang-filter, ensuring a more stable data processing flow.
Feature Value: This fix resolves errors in the data decoding process, enhancing the system's reliability and user experience, and preventing potential data loss or processing anomalies. -
Related PR: #2743
Contributor: @Jing-ze
Change Log: This PR fixes the error when settingip_source_typetoorigin-source, ensuring that the IP restriction feature can be correctly configured based on the source type.
Feature Value: This fix resolves the issue of incorrect IP source type settings under specific conditions, enhancing the system's stability and security, and allowing users to more reliably use the IP restriction feature. -
Related PR: #2723
Contributor: @CH3CHO
Change Log: This PR corrects the functional anomaly in the C++ Wasm plugin due to using an incorrect attribute name in the_match_service_rule, restoring the rule by modifying it to the correct attribute name.
Feature Value: This fix resolves the service routing issue caused by an incorrect matching rule, enhancing the system's stability and accuracy, and ensuring that users can correctly access the desired services. -
Related PR: #2706
Contributor: @WeixinX
Change Log: This PR fixes the issue where the transformer performs an add operation when the key does not exist, and adds test cases for mapping operations, ensuring correct transformations from headers/query to body and from body to headers/query.
Feature Value: This fix enhances the system's stability and reliability, preventing erroneous data operations, and boosting user confidence in the data processing logic, thereby improving the user experience. -
Related PR: #2663
Contributor: @CH3CHO
Change Log: This PR fixes the error in the bedrock model name escaping logic, removes unnecessary URL encoding in the request body, and ensures that the response matches expectations.
Feature Value: By correcting the name escaping logic issue, this fix enhances the system's stability and compatibility, ensuring that users do not encounter issues due to mismatched escaping during use. -
Related PR: #2653
Contributor: @johnlanni
Change Log: This PR fixes the issue where the AI route fallback function fails when using Bedrock. It ensures that the path can be correctly obtained even when headers are nil, avoiding null pointer exceptions.
Feature Value: This fix resolves the issue of request rejection due to signature verification failure under specific conditions, enhancing the system's stability and reliability, and ensuring that users can smoothly access the service. -
Related PR: #2628
Contributor: @co63oc
Change Log: This PR corrects spelling errors in multiple files, involving 5 files and 36 lines of code, ensuring the accuracy of the documentation and comments.
Feature Value: Correcting spelling errors enhances the professionalism of the codebase, allowing developers to more accurately understand the content when reading the documentation, thereby reducing errors caused by misunderstandings.
